Rakuten International is a division of Rakuten Group, Inc., a Japanese global technology leader in services that empower individuals, communities, businesses and society. Headquartered in San Mateo, California with more than 4,000 employees worldwide, the Rakuten International business portfolio includes market leaders in e-commerce, digital marketing, advertising, communications and entertainment. Travel Requirements: - This role includes domestic and international travel to support major industry events, executive speaking engagements, and strategic initiatives. #LI-RM14 Five Principles for Success Our worldwide practices describe specific behaviors that make Rakuten unique and united across the world. We expect Rakuten employees to model these 5 Shugi Principles of Success. Always improve, Always Advance - Only be satisfied with complete success - Kaizen Passionately Professional - Take an uncompromising approach to your work and be determined to be the best Hypothesize - Practice - Validate – Shikumika - Use the Rakuten Cycle to succeed in unknown territory Maximize Customer Satisfaction - The greatest satisfaction for our teams is seeing their customers smile Speed!! Speed!! Speed!! - Always be conscious of time - take charge, set clear goals, and engage your team Rakuten provides equal employment opportunities to all employees and applicants for employment and prohibits discrimination and harassment of any type.
